The Agilent 6000 Series oscilloscopes deliver powerful features
and high performance:
• 100 MHz, 300 MHz, 500 MHz, and 1 GHz bandwidth models.
• Up to 4 GSa/s sample rate.

• USB, LAN, and GPIB ports make printing, saving and
sharing data easy.
• 2-channel and 4-channel Digital Storage Oscilloscope (DSO)
models.
• 2+16-channel and 4+16-channel Mixed Signal Oscilloscope
(MSO) models.
• Color XGA display on 6000A Series models.
• 6000L models are LXI class C compliant, in a 1 unit high
package.
• An MSO lets you debug your mixed-signal designs using up
to four analog signals and 16 tightly correlated digital
signals simultaneously.
• You can easily upgrade a 6000A or 6000L Series oscilloscope
from a DSO to an MSO.
• You can easily increase memory depth of a 6000A Series
oscilloscope. Maximum memory depth is standard in 6000L
Series oscilloscopes.

The 6000 Series oscilloscopes feature MegaZoom III technology:
• Most responsive deep memory.
• Highest definition color display (6000A models).
• Fastest waveform update rates, uncompromised.
